Our territory managers work with professional on-site maintenance teams to make sure your RV is meticulously maintained throughout the year. Your RV will benefit form ongoing attention and basic maintenance like tire checks before and after each rental, roof and slide out checks once a month, ongoing appliance testing, routine oil changes, and more. We want your RV in top shape all the time so that it can continue to perform well and generate revenue. As an RV owner in our program, there are 3 main types of maintenance costs to consider:
1) Routine maintenance: Oil changes, tire rotations, etc. Owners are billed periodically for these expenses at discounted rates, and the deduction can often come directly from the rental profits in a given month.
2) Rental Damages: Any damage to an RV that happens on a rental will be covered fully by the renter's security deposit and/or the commercial insurance coverage. Our managers deal with all claims and repairs at no cost to the RV owner - renters pay the deductible and your personal insurance is not involved.
3) Systemic maintenance: Systemic issues are the responsibility of the RV owner. A/C failure, water pump failure, fridge or hot water tank failure, etc. These are costs that arise from no fault of the renter. Warranty protection plans usually cover these systemic repairs, and our managers work with the warranty company and RV techs to get these fixed. Our managers will work with you to get your RV back in top shape as quickly and professionally as possible.
We will consider any RV that is in great condition but we focus mostly on newer Class A, B, and C motorhomes and late model travel trailers with bunk beds. We also will consider fifth wheels and custom conversion campervans. Every RV must be 5 years or newer to qualify for rental management. Sometimes we make exceptions for very well maintained older units.
